Blackstone, Inc. in New York, NY, seeks a Senior Associate, Private Equity to analyze financial data and developments in financial markets important to the business of the Blackstone Group. Act as point person for transactions: work with senior management and coordinate analyst responsibilities. Conduct research of targeted industries for investment purposes. Perform valuation analyses of prospective investment opportunities under consideration, including the assessment of financial risks. Compare a company's financial data with other companies of the same industry, size and location to forecast industry trends. Design and develop quantitative models to assess the economic performance of targeted companies. Prepare written analyses and evaluations of investment opportunities for use by Blackstone Group management and review by clients. Oversee the execution of transactions. Participate in both internal and external client meetings, negotiation of contracts and other agreements, and due diligence sessions. Oversee current portfolio companies and analyze potential exit opportunities. Perform other duties as needed. A minimum of a Bachelors degree (or foreign equivalent) in Finance, Economics, or a related field plus 4 years of experience in job offered or related occupations required. Also required: 4 years of experience in: performing financial analysis for private and public evaluating financial statements, board decks, analysts projections and key metrics; advising on M&A transactions both on the sellside and buyside advising on over $30B of total transaction value across 6 deals; providing fairness opinions advising public companies on M&A transactions and performing DCF analyses, LBO analyses, transaction comparables, trading comparables and sum of the parts valuations; using Microsoft excel for financial modeling and Microsoft power point for external presentation materials; using FactSet and CapitalIQ (and their respective excel add-ins), software used to access historical and projected information for public companies.
